Output 8964e39bbb12a5f6ee280f08b5d592541a71ca83f5aab17d1a23fa030ea0654b:0

value
86665411
script pubkey
OP_0 OP_PUSHBYTES_20 14bd40109c9bb47da145c0e84f8bb7e840c73c93
address
ltc1qzj75qyyunw68mg29cr5ylzahapqvw0yn2xufs9
transaction
8964e39bbb12a5f6ee280f08b5d592541a71ca83f5aab17d1a23fa030ea0654b
spent
true